Archaeomagnetic data from ancient baked clays is a precious source of information about the past variations of the Earth's magnetic field. Thanks to archaeomagnetic records from well dated archaeological artefacts it is possible to reconstruct the geomagnetic field variations in the past and better understand its behaviour. On the other hand, once a detailed secular variation path is established for a certain area, reliable archaeomagnetic dating is possible. In order to enrich the Italian reference database and extend it back in time, we present here the results of an archaeomagnetic study carried out on three Neolithic ovens excavated at the archaeological site of Portonovo (Marche, Italy)
